Modifs in menus
[odoo/odoo.git] / addons / delivery / delivery_view.xml
1 <?xml version="1.0"?>
2 <terp>
3 <data>
4         #
5         # Delivery Carriers
6         # 
7         <menuitem
8                 parent="stock.menu_stock_configuration"
9                 name="Delivery"
10                 id="menu_delivery"
11                 sequence="4"/>
12
13         <record model="ir.ui.view" id="view_delivery_carrier_tree">
14                 <field name="name">delivery.carrier.tree</field>
15                 <field name="model">delivery.carrier</field>
16                 <field name="type">tree</field>
17                 <field name="arch" type="xml">
18                         <tree string="Carrier">
19                                 <field name="name"/>
20                                 <field name="partner_id"/>
21                         </tree>
22                 </field>
23         </record>
24         <record model="ir.ui.view" id="view_delivery_carrier_form">
25                 <field name="name">delivery.carrier.form</field>
26                 <field name="model">delivery.carrier</field>
27                 <field name="type">form</field>
28                 <field name="arch" type="xml">
29                         <form string="Carrier">
30                                 <field name="name" select="1"/>
31                                 <field name="active" select="1"/>
32                                 <field name="partner_id" select="1"/>
33                                 <field name="product_id" select="1"/>
34                         </form>
35                 </field>
36         </record>
37         <record model="ir.actions.act_window" id="action_delivery_carrier_form">
38                 <field name="name">Delivery Method</field>
39                 <field name="type">ir.actions.act_window</field>
40                 <field name="res_model">delivery.carrier</field>
41                 <field name="view_type">form</field>
42                 <field name="view_mode">tree,form</field>
43         </record>
44         <menuitem 
45                 parent="menu_delivery"
46                 id="menu_action_delivery_carrier_form" 
47                 action="action_delivery_carrier_form"/>
48
49         #
50         # Delivery Grids
51         # 
52
53         <record model="ir.ui.view" id="view_delivery_grid_tree">
54                 <field name="name">delivery.grid.tree</field>
55                 <field name="model">delivery.grid</field>
56                 <field name="type">tree</field>
57                 <field name="arch" type="xml">
58                         <tree string="Delivery grids">
59                                 <field name="sequence"/>
60                                 <field name="carrier_id"/>
61                                 <field name="name"/>
62                         </tree>
63                 </field>
64         </record>
65
66         <record model="ir.ui.view" id="view_delivery_grid_form">
67                 <field name="name">delivery.grid.form</field>
68                 <field name="model">delivery.grid</field>
69                 <field name="type">form</field>
70                 <field name="arch" type="xml">
71                         <form string="Delivery grids">
72                                 <notebook>
73                                 <page string="Grid definition">
74                                         <field name="name" select="1"/>
75                                         <field name="active" select="1"/>
76                                         <field name="carrier_id" select="1"/>
77                                         <field name="sequence" select="1"/>
78                                         <separator colspan="4" string="Grid Lines"/>
79                                         <field name="line_ids" select="1" colspan="4" nolabel="1"/>
80                                 </page><page string="Destination">
81                                         <field name="country_ids" colspan="4"/>
82                                         <field name="state_ids" colspan="4"/>
83                                         <field name="zip_from"/>
84                                         <field name="zip_to"/>
85                                 </page>
86                                 </notebook>
87                         </form>
88                 </field>
89         </record>
90         <record model="ir.actions.act_window" id="action_delivery_grid_form">
91                 <field name="name">Delivery Pricelist</field>
92                 <field name="type">ir.actions.act_window</field>
93                 <field name="res_model">delivery.grid</field>
94                 <field name="view_type">form</field>
95                 <field name="view_mode">tree,form</field>
96         </record>
97         <menuitem
98                 parent="menu_delivery"
99                 id="menu_action_delivery_grid_form"
100                 action="action_delivery_grid_form"/>
101
102         <record model="ir.ui.view" id="view_delivery_grid_line_form">
103                 <field name="name">delivery.grid.line.form</field>
104                 <field name="model">delivery.grid.line</field>
105                 <field name="type">form</field>
106                 <field name="arch" type="xml">
107                         <form string="Grid Lines">
108                                 <field name="name" select="1" colspan="4"/>
109                                 <field name="type" string="Condition"/>
110                                 <field name="operator" nolabel="1"/>
111                                 <field name="max_value" nolabel="1"/>
112                                 <field name="list_price"/>
113                                 <field name="standard_price"/>
114                                 <field name="price_type"/>
115                                 <field name="variable_factor"/>
116                         </form>
117                 </field>
118         </record>
119         <record model="ir.ui.view" id="view_delivery_grid_line_tree">
120                 <field name="name">delivery.grid.line.tree</field>
121                 <field name="model">delivery.grid.line</field>
122                 <field name="type">tree</field>
123                 <field name="arch" type="xml">
124                         <tree string="Grid Lines">
125                                 <field name="name"/>
126                                 <field name="type"/>
127                                 <field name="operator"/>
128                                 <field name="max_value"/>
129                                 <field name="list_price"/>
130                                 <field name="standard_price"/>
131                         </tree>
132                 </field>
133         </record>
134
135
136
137
138
139                 <record model="ir.ui.view" id="view_order_withcarrier_form">
140                         <field name="name">delivery.sale.order_withcarrier.form.view</field>
141                         <field name="type">form</field>
142                         <field name="model">sale.order</field>
143                         <field name="inherit_id" ref="sale.view_order_form" />
144                         <field name="arch" type="xml">
145                                 <field name="client_order_ref" position="after">
146                                                 <field name="carrier_id" /> 
147                                 </field>
148                         </field>
149                 </record>
150
151                 <record model="ir.ui.view" id="view_picking_withcarrier_form">
152                         <field name="name">delivery.stock.picking_withcarrier.form.view</field>
153                         <field name="type">form</field>
154                         <field name="model">stock.picking</field>
155                         <field name="inherit_id" ref="stock.view_picking_delivery_form" />
156                         <field name="arch" type="xml">
157                                 <field name="address_id" position="after">
158                                         <field name="volume"/>
159                                         <field name="weight"/>
160                                         <field name="carrier_id"/>
161                                 </field>
162                         </field>
163                 </record>
164                 <record model="ir.ui.view" id="view_picking_withcarrier_out_form">
165                         <field name="name">delivery.stock.picking_withcarrier.out.form.view</field>
166                         <field name="type">form</field>
167                         <field name="model">stock.picking</field>
168                         <field name="inherit_id" ref="stock.view_picking_out_form" />
169                         <field name="arch" type="xml">
170                                 <field name="address_id" position="after">
171                                         <field name="volume"/>
172                                         <field name="weight"/>
173                                         <field name="carrier_id"/>
174                                 </field>
175                         </field>
176                 </record>
177
178                 <record model="ir.ui.view" id="view_picking_withcarrier_delivery_form">
179                         <field name="name">delivery.stock.picking_withcarrier.delivery.form.view</field>
180                         <field name="type">form</field>
181                         <field name="model">stock.picking</field>
182                         <field name="inherit_id" ref="stock.view_picking_delivery_form" />
183                         <field name="arch" type="xml">
184                                 <field name="address_id" position="after">
185                                         <field name="volume"/>
186                                         <field name="weight"/>
187                                         <field name="carrier_id"/>
188                                 </field>
189                         </field>
190                 </record>
191
192         <record model="ir.actions.act_window" id="action_picking_tree4">
193                 <field name="name">Packings to be invoiced</field>
194                 <field name="res_model">stock.picking</field>
195                 <field name="type">ir.actions.act_window</field>
196                 <field name="view_type">form</field>
197                 <field name="view_mode">tree,form</field>
198                 <field name="domain">[('invoice_state','=','2binvoiced'),('state','=','done'),('type','=','out')]</field>
199         </record>
200         <menuitem
201                 parent="stock.menu_action_picking_tree"
202                 id="menu_action_picking_tree3"
203                 action="action_picking_tree4"/>
204
205
206         <record model="ir.actions.act_window" id="action_picking_tree5">
207                 <field name="name">Generate Draft Invoices On Receptions</field>
208                 <field name="res_model">stock.picking</field>
209                 <field name="type">ir.actions.act_window</field>
210                 <field name="view_type">form</field>
211                 <field name="view_mode">tree,form</field>
212                 <field name="domain">[('invoice_state','=','2binvoiced'),('state','=','done'),('type','=','in')]</field>
213         </record>
214         <menuitem
215                 parent="stock.action_picking_tree4"
216                 id="menu_action_picking_tree5"
217                 action="action_picking_tree5"/>
218
219
220 </data>
221 </terp>